Head of Pastoral and Activity

Job Description: Head of Pastoral and Activity

Job Overview:
The Head of Pastoral and Activity is responsible for promoting the overall social, emotional, and behavioural well-being of students while ensuring full compliance with KHDA guidelines. This role involves providing leadership in pastoral care, managing extracurricular activities, and fostering a positive school culture that supports holistic student development. The ideal candidate will demonstrate strong leadership, empathy, and organisational skills, with a deep understanding of student welfare and engagement in a school environment.


Key Responsibilities:

Student Welfare & Well-being:
  • Oversee and implement pastoral care programs that support students’ personal, emotional, and behavioural growth.
  • Ensure early identification and intervention for students requiring social or emotional support.
  • Collaborate with counsellors, class teachers, and parents to address student well-being concerns.
  • Promote positive discipline, inclusivity, and mutual respect across the school community.
Leadership & Coordination:
  • Lead and guide pastoral teams to maintain a caring and supportive school environment.
  • Oversee extracurricular, enrichment, and co-curricular activity planning to ensure balanced student participation.
  • Manage timetabling and substitution efficiently to maintain smooth academic and activity schedules.
  • Coordinate with section heads, activity leaders, and counsellors for effective student engagement.
Policy & Compliance:
  • Ensure all pastoral and student welfare initiatives are aligned with KHDA regulations and school policies.
  • Maintain accurate documentation related to attendance, discipline, and student welfare records.
  • Conduct regular audits to ensure adherence to safeguarding and child protection guidelines.
Communication & Engagement:
  • Act as a liaison between students, parents, and teachers regarding behavioural and emotional well-being.
  • Organise assemblies, awareness programs, and campaigns promoting values, leadership, and resilience.
  • Foster a culture of openness, empathy, and inclusivity through effective communication strategies.
Professional Development & Training:
  • Provide training and workshops for teachers on student well-being, behaviour management, and emotional support.
  • Stay updated with pastoral best practices and KHDA updates related to student welfare.
  • Participate in leadership meetings and contribute to the school’s strategic development initiatives.

Qualifications & Requirements:

Education: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Education, Counselling, or a related field (mandatory).
  • A Master’s degree in Educational Leadership, Psychology, or related discipline is preferred.

Experience:

  • Minimum 5 years of teaching or pastoral leadership experience in a school setting (mandatory).
  • Strong knowledge of KHDA regulations and compliance requirements.
  • Proven experience in timetabling and substitution management.

Visa Status:

  • Candidates with Spouse Visa, Own Visa, or Employment Visa are preferred.

Skills & Attributes:
  • Excellent interpersonal, communication, and leadership skills.
  • Strong organisational and time-management abilities.
  • Empathetic, student-focused approach with high emotional intelligence.
  • Ability to collaborate across teams and maintain confidentiality.
  • Strategic mindset for managing student welfare programs and extracurricular planning.
